These electrodes are specially designed for welding 410 and 410NiMo martensitic stainless steels, which are often used in situations that require exceptional strength, toughness, and resistance to corrosion. With features like excellent arc stability, easy slag removal, and crack resistance, E410NiMo-16 electrodes guarantee strong and durable welds. They’re perfect for industries that need outstanding performance in harsh and corrosive environments.
AWS Class E410NiMo-16 Electrodes are made up of chromium (11.5–14%), nickel (3.5–4.5%), molybdenum (0.4–0.65%), manganese (≤1%), silicon (≤1%), and carbon up to 0.04%. This well-balanced composition boosts hardness, strength, and resistance to both corrosion and erosion. The mechanical properties include a tensile strength ranging from 650 to 750 MPa, a yield strength of about 450 MPa, and an elongation of 18 to 22%. The weld deposits offer high toughness, excellent wear resistance, and stability, even when faced with stress and fluctuating temperatures.

AWS Class E410NiMo-16 electrodes are primarily used for welding stainless steel and low-alloy steel structures in industries requiring high strength, toughness and resistance to stress corrosion cracking. These electrodes are ideal for applications in the chemical, petrochemical, power generation, and shipbuilding industries. Their high nickel content enhances weldability and resistance to pitting, crevice corrosion and oxidation. E410NiMo-16 electrodes are commonly employed for welding dissimilar metals, ensuring reliable performance under harsh environmental conditions, especially in high-temperature and corrosive environments.
